Transaction 393a9d00310bd175329dc4a395709bf1892b15c5c4e84be250e80c143a50c365
1 Input
1 Output
-
393a9d00310bd175329dc4a395709bf1892b15c5c4e84be250e80c143a50c365:0
- value
- 325897514
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 66eb01e2bd407bba5ff8028f36cf8f08b117efbe OP_EQUALVERIFY OP_CHECKSIG
- address
- 1APBTAZEKpfxfA4EHHhEbwnBU4XTWpnzMb